Getting There
-
Car
If you are driving, start from the city of Ústí nad Labem. Take the D8 highway towards Prague for approximately 25 km and then take exit 66 toward Hřensko. Follow the signs for Hřensko and continue on Route 62 for about 18 km until you reach the village of Hřensko. From Hřensko, follow the signs to Pravčická Archway, which is about 5 km away. There is a parking area near the entrance, which may charge a small fee (around 100 CZK) for parking.
-
Public Transportation
To reach Pravčická Archway by public transport, start by taking a train from Ústí nad Labem to Děčín. Trains run frequently and the journey takes about 30 minutes. Once in Děčín, transfer to a bus heading to Hřensko. The bus ride will take approximately 30 minutes. After arriving in Hřensko, follow the signs or ask locals for directions to Pravčická Archway, which is about a 5 km walk from the bus stop. Be prepared for some uphill walking. Bus tickets can be purchased at the station or on the bus, and prices are usually around 30 CZK.
-
Hiking
For the more adventurous, consider hiking to Pravčická Archway. Start your hike from Hřensko, which can be reached by car or public transport as described above. The hike takes approximately 1.5 to 2 hours depending on your pace and the route you choose. There are marked trails leading to the archway, with stunning views along the way. Make sure to wear comfortable hiking shoes and carry water, as the path can be steep and rugged.
